Well, I just took a look into it and, quite simply, the texture file is for a purple book.

The .nif contains only two objects, the books' covers and the books' pages (which uses a vanilla texture)

As it stands, the .nif is quite simply for a stack of duplicate books.

The make each book different, You'd need to modify the .nif so that each book cover is its own object and calls a different texture, or re-map the one so that each different book only uses a portion of the texture and modify the texture to have numerous covers.

Multiple textures would probably be the easiest way to make the stack look how you want as you could control each book individually. If you'd like I could probably do it in a couple of minutes.

What you're saying you want, is exactly what I get. Eight identical dark grey books, with a very slight purple tinge to them.

ZBookStack.dds & ZBookStack_n.dds in the textures directory (sloppy but that's where the .nifs are looking for them.) and the .nifs nestled somewhere in the meshes folders, and they should work fine.

The ZBookStack.dds is the texture for the covers in the screenshots, and it is included in the .zip, it's just that there's no directory tree in the .zip so you need to manually move the files to the right locations.

 

Edit,,,,

I just tried it with the textures in the wrong location. What I got was eight completely black books with vanilla page ends.

The only thing I can think of is if you overwrote ZBookStack.dds with ZBookstack_n.dds or changed the .nif to use ZBookStack_n.dds as the primary texture. Just how vivid of a purple are we talking here?
